Synonymous with comfort and quality in athletic footwear and apparel, the New Balance brand has a rich history dating back to 1906. Originally founded as the New Balance Arch Support Company, it has evolved considerably over the years. Known for its technical innovations such as mixed gel insoles and different shoe widths, New Balance offers products that combine functionality with fashion. The company's commitment to manufacturing in the United States and the United Kingdom is a testament to its dedication to quality and craftsmanship. With sales of $5.3 billion in 2022, New Balance continues to be a key player in the sports industry, catering to athletes and casual users alike.
